How many terawatthour in 1 British thermal unit? The answer is 2.9307108333333E-13. We assume you are converting between terawatthour and British thermal unit. You can view more details on each measurement unit: terawatthour or British thermal unit The SI derived unit for energy is the joule. 1 joule is equal to 2.7777777777778E-16 terawatthour, or 0.00094781707774915 British thermal unit. Definition: Btu

The British thermal unit (BTU or Btu) is a non-metric unit of energy, used in the United States and, to a lesser extent, the UK (where it isgenerally only used for heating systems). The SI unit is the joule (J), which is used by most other countries.
